Comprehensive Guide to uninsured third party claim

What is the Uninsured Third Party Claim Form?

The Uninsured Third Party Claim Form serves a critical role in vehicle accident claims in New Zealand. It is specifically designed for situations involving uninsured drivers, helping claimants report accidents and seek damages. This form can be utilized by various parties, including claimants, drivers, and witnesses, thereby broadening its accessibility for those involved in vehicle-related incidents.

Purpose and Benefits of the Uninsured Third Party Claim Form

The necessity of filling out the Uninsured Third Party Claim Form arises primarily from the legal requirement to claim damages from uninsured drivers. Utilizing this form can significantly enhance the chances of a successful claim, and it provides a clear pathway for obtaining potential compensation. By formally documenting the accident and the involved parties, users can streamline their claim process and ensure they meet legal obligations.

Key Features of the Uninsured Third Party Claim Form

Several distinctive features characterize the Uninsured Third Party Claim Form:
  • Owner details, which include the vehicle owner's name and contact information.
  • Accident specifics, outlining the date, time, and location of the incident.
  • Information about all parties involved in the accident, including their roles.
  • Signature requirements mandate signatures from the claimant, driver, and a witness.

Who Needs the Uninsured Third Party Claim Form?

This form is essential for individuals directly involved in an accident with an uninsured vehicle. The claimants, who are seeking damages, as well as drivers and witnesses, must understand their roles in the claim process. Scenarios necessitating the completion of this form often include instances where vehicles lack the required insurance coverage, making it crucial for impacted parties to know when to file.

The Uninsured Third Party Claim Form is available for any individual involved in an accident with an uninsured vehicle in New Zealand. This includes claimants, drivers, and witnesses.
You should prepare to submit supporting documents such as police reports, photographs of the accident scene, and any other relevant evidence along with the completed Uninsured Third Party Claim Form.
